We welcome contributions on a broad range of topics, including but not limited to:
- Contemporary challenges in management and organizational science (e.g., organizational resilience, digital twins, discrimination, subjective performance evaluation).
- Agent-based models for sustainable transitions in organization, management, and economics.
- Microeconomic ABMs: Market structure formation and the role of ABM in game theory.
- Macroeconomic ABMs: Economic crises, growth patterns, and social dynamics influenced by self-fulfilling prophecies, business cycles, and climate change.
- Modeling human behavior, group decision-making, and collective intelligence.
- Empirical validation challenges for agent-based models in organization, management, and economics.
- Hybrid methodologies: Integrating ABM with other modeling approaches.
- Ensuring transparency and reproducibility in ABM research.
- Innovative applications and novel methodological advancements in ABM.
